When you have a federal education loan, find out if it really is a primary loan or Federal Family Education Loan (FFEL).

For those who have an educatonal loan which was supplied by or fully guaranteed by the authorities, your loan most most likely falls into 1 of 2 groups: direct loans or indirect loans. Indirect loans will also be called Federal Family Education Loans (FFELs). Things will get perplexing, however, because various types of loans—such as Stafford or PLUS loans—can be either a primary loan or an indirect loan.

Keep reading to locate the difference out between a primary loan and an indirect loan/FFEL loan.

Direct vs. Indirect Federal Loans

Federal student education loans are either direct loans or loans that are indirect. They are split from personal student education loans, that have nothing at all to do with the national federal government, and they are given by personal lenders, just like just about any types of loan you could get for a home or a vehicle or even for retail acquisitions. Direct Loans

Direct loans are loans supplied to you personally straight because of the U.S. Department of Education.

Indirect Loans/FFELs

Indirect loans are loans that have been supplied by personal organizations, but assured because of the government that is federal. These loans in many cases are called Federal Family Education Loans, or FFELs. The federal government doesn’t insure FFELs, directly but alternatively acts by way of a guarantor. If you default on the loan, the guarantor can pay the financial institution for your loan. The federal government in change reimburses the guarantor. When you yourself have an indirect/FFEL, you certainly will almost constantly deal directly with all the loan provider, guarantor, servicer or collection agency—not the government. This year, the federal federal government eliminated the guarantors along with other middlemen by moving legislation payday loans online tennessee closing the FFEL program. After June 30, 2010, borrowers can simply get loans that are direct.

Direct and Indirect Loan Types

There are lots of loan kinds, some of which may be either a primary loan or a loan that is indirect. In the event that you took down your loan after June 30, 2010, nevertheless, your loan is going to be a loan that is direct.

Stafford Loans

Here is the many type that is common of loan. Stafford loans may be subsidized or unsubsidized. Subsidized loans are need-based, whereas unsubsidized Stafford loans aren’t.

Subsidized loans usually do not accrue interest during times you might be deferring re payment, as an example, while you’re nevertheless at school. Unsubsidized loans will accrue interest during deferment. The essential difference between that which you’ll buy a subsidized plus an unsubsidized loan could be significant in the event that loan is deferred within a college program that is multi-year.

PLUS Loans

PLUS loans would be the only forms of federal loans that want a credit check. Usually, moms and dads will obtain a Parent PLUS loan on the part of the youngster. Parents are going to be in charge of payment and you will be the mark of collection when they default.

Perkins Loans

Perkins Loans, a various sort of loan, are need based loans. Perkins loans got down by schools, with cash supplied by the Department of Education. Particular standard guidelines and repayment choices are somewhat various with Perkins loans.

Under federal legislation, the authority for schools in order to make brand new Perkins Loans finished on September 30, 2017, with last disbursements allowed through June 30, 2018. Because of this, pupils can no receive Perkins Loans longer.

Consolidation Loans

A consolidation loan is really a split loan that takes care of a borrower’s existing loans into one larger loan after payment in the loans has started. (find out more about pupil consolidation loans. )
